What to Expect
Become a brave explorer on a thrilling quest through the library’s shelves designed especially for children aged 8 to 12 years. This interactive puzzle adventure invites young readers to wind their way through both fiction and non-fiction sections, cracking riddles, decoding clues, and uncovering surprises along the way.
Each challenge transports participants from storybook realms to real-world wonders, encouraging teamwork, imagination, and sharp problem-solving skills to successfully navigate the library labyrinth. It’s a fun and engaging way to inspire a love of reading and learning during the school holidays.
Parents or guardians are required to sign in and stay within the library space for the duration of the activity, ensuring a safe and supportive environment for all children.
